3 months agoSahara Desert is one of the most beautiful and mystical places on earthINDIA BEAUTIFUL TOURIST PLACE IN BHARAT
2 months agoPokhara Nepal Latest Video | Pokhara Tourist Places| Pokhara Nepal Travel Vlog | Pokhara LakesideAdvocateTravelCouple